KOSPI Surges Past 7,100 as Samsung and SK Hynix Lead Tech Charge

The KOSPI index in South Korea surged past 7,100 on Tuesday, driven by gains in tech-heavy stocks like Samsung Electronics and SK Hynix. This rally comes after Monday's sharp jump of over 4% in the previous session.

Samsung Electronics rose 2.59%, while SK Hynix gained 3.98%. Foreign and institutional investors were net buyers, purchasing more than 610 billion won of shares by late morning, offsetting heavy selling from retail investors.

The rally reflects renewed confidence in the memory-chip cycle, with KB Securities expecting exceptionally tight memory supply next year and estimates inventories at Samsung and SK Hynix have fallen below 10 days. Nomura Securities also sees these two stocks as deeply undervalued relative to the expected expansion in global semiconductor capacity.

In contrast, Japan's Nikkei 225 struggled for direction on Tuesday, weighed down by a rapidly strengthening yen that has revived expectations for a Bank of Japan rate increase.
